Power outages can create serious problems for homes, businesses, and commercial facilities. For homeowners, an outage can mean losing heating, cooling, refrigeration, lighting, internet, sump pump operation, and daily comfort. For businesses, it can interrupt operations, damage equipment, affect customers, and create safety concerns.

Backup generator installation is one of the most effective ways to maintain power during outages, but choosing the right generator requires more than picking a unit size from a brochure. The electrical load, transfer switch, fuel source, installation location, and permitting requirements all need to be considered.

Why Generator Sizing Matters

One of the most important parts of generator installation is proper sizing. A generator that is too small may not support the systems the property owner expects. A generator that is too large can add unnecessary cost and may not operate as efficiently as it should.

For residential properties, the question is usually whether the generator needs to support the whole home or only essential circuits. Essential loads may include the refrigerator, furnace, air conditioning, sump pump, garage door opener, internet equipment, lighting, and selected outlets.

For commercial properties, the load calculation may include security systems, refrigeration, emergency lighting, communication systems, office equipment, point-of-sale systems, production equipment, or other critical operations.

Transfer Switches Are a Critical Part of the System

A backup generator must be connected safely through a transfer switch. The transfer switch separates the property from utility power when the generator is operating. This prevents unsafe backfeeding and allows the generator to power selected circuits or the full electrical system depending on the design.

Automatic transfer switches are commonly used with standby generators. When utility power goes out, the system detects the outage and transfers power to the generator. When utility power is restored, the system switches back.

Manual transfer switches may be used in certain applications, but the right choice depends on the property, generator type, and intended use.

Residential and Commercial Generator Installation

Generator installation can support both residential and commercial needs. Homeowners may want protection during storms, winter outages, or sump pump failures. Businesses may need backup power to protect operations, customers, data, equipment, or revenue.

Restaurants, offices, warehouses, medical-related spaces, retail stores, churches, and industrial facilities can all benefit from a properly planned backup power system.
